Autumn months young foxes living in the  country side lose up to 30% of their body weight catching mice is not as easy as it looks  so they feed mainly on earthworms insects and windfall yeah young foxes also have some  difficulty distinguishing friend and [Music]

[Music] foe adult hairs and  deer have nothing to fear from [Music] foxes [Music] this deer obviously wants to   ensure that the young fox is aware  of [Music] it real danger lurks elsewhere foxes have always been hunted employing  a plethora of methods for example hunters play  

So-called Mouse card castles within the range  of their hides soft straw and a filled food   tube are designed to encourage mice to nest  and with their scent to lure foxes in front   of the Hunter’s gun annually more than a  million foxes are killed in Germany and  

France ostensibly for species protection and  disease prevention but Western Europe has been   rabies free for a long time and the spread  of fox tapeworm may even be exasperated by hunting elaborate investigations also  revealed that biodiversity suffers   primarily from industrial Agriculture and  that hunting can’t actually regulate the fox

Population because where foxes are  hunted and their family structures   are destroyed they crank up reproduction  then even lower ranked Vixens give birth   to an above average number of Cubs in order to  counteract the [Music] losses a questionable   Vicious [Music] Circle for this reason ever  more experts demand the prohibition of funks Hunting Urban foxes are safe from hunters  and live surprisingly species [Music] appropriate due to the large food  supply there are comparatively many foxes here nonetheless encounters with them  are still rare and special for most City dwellers unless of course they regularly share  the night shift with the foxes many policemen  

And security guards know their own foxes  personally and observe them with collegial   sympathy after all foxes are the health police  responsible for rabbish and rodent infestation rats and mice are Hiles meaning  they follow us humans wherever we go roughly 8 million rats live in Berlin  and probably just as many [Music] mice  

Far too many for their numbers to be sign  significantly decreased by Foxes a virtual [Music] Paradise no wonder that  Urban foxes who learn to figure   out traffic rules live far longer  lives than their relatives in the countryside [Music] excellent prospects for the young  foxxes of the government [Music]

Foxes are true survivors, at home in all regions of the Earth. Nowadays, the smart animals also feel at home in our cities. As an example, a close-knit clan has been living in Berlin’s government district for many years.
High up in the North on the German coast, a vixen raises her litter alone. Rarely is there enough to feed everyone. Like after a storm, for example, when the vixen finds a lot to eat in the drift line on the beach. The little ones have to grow up fast, as once the autumn arrives, their single parent mother’s reserves are exhausted and she drives them out of her territory.
For more than two years, filmmakers Roland Gockel and Rosie Koch kept track of the foxes in Berlin, Hamburg and on the North German coast. With the help of hidden cameras, they were able to unearth many secrets of the clever animals.
